/* EasyOnWeb — Remises clients WooCommerce : styles frontend (neutre, sans font-family imposee). */

.eow-discount-price {
    display: inline-flex;
    flex-direction: column;
    align-items: flex-start;
    line-height: 1.1;
}

.eow-discount-price-top {
    display: flex;
    gap: 6px;
    align-items: center;
    font-size: 13px;
    font-weight: 700;
}

/* Ancien prix : barre, en noir. */
.eow-base-price {
    color: #000;
    text-decoration: line-through;
}

.eow-base-price del,
.eow-base-price ins {
    color: inherit;
    text-decoration: inherit;
}

/* Pourcentage de remise : rouge. */
.eow-discount-percent {
    color: #d60000;
}

/* Nouveau prix : vert. */
.eow-final-price {
    font-size: 24px;
    font-weight: 900;
    color: #1a8a1a;
}

/*
 * Le prix de variation natif (en bas, sous les sélecteurs) est masqué dès que le JS
 * a posé la classe .eow-price-moved : le prix est remonté en haut, on évite le doublon.
 * La règle ne s'applique que si le JS a tourné (classe présente) : sans JS, rien n'est caché.
 */
.eow-price-moved .single_variation .woocommerce-variation-price {
    display: none !important;
}
